MKG was easily our most valuable player last year, when he played. He was just hurt a lot (four separate injuries). His play so far this year is nothing new, just damn refreshing. He's still the most valuable player on the team, as constructed. He single-handedly does two things 1) He takes our defense from decent/bad to good 2) Takes us from a solid rebounding team to a great rebounding team. He has the same impact as a great defensive center, yet he does it from the 3 spot. Only a handful of players in the league can impact a game as much on defense from the wing - MKG, Leonard, Tony Allen etc... And Allen doesn't also impact the rebounding like MKG and Leonard.

In the 3 games since his return our team Drtg is 98, which would be 2nd in the league behind the Spurs' ridiculous 94 rating. Our net rating of 3 would put us in the top 10. We lead the league with a defensive rebounding % of 80. With MKG that number has been a staggering 85%. Even better our offensive rebounding % with MKG has gone from 20% (bottom 5) to 28% (top 5). Our overall rebounding % with MKG is 56% which would be top in the league.

Yeah, Yeah... tiny sample sizes, but a step in the right direction.
